Output 81d20a78d1e04713ce0447fee6d53670eb2dabc175cace1ec443dfa06fda819d:4

value
12964987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fb4ee36bbc893fea21aac7c10f14566e53398b OP_EQUAL
address
3LqJCqHDBLADTccMXTjwRukY2VjKxRGuaP
transaction
81d20a78d1e04713ce0447fee6d53670eb2dabc175cace1ec443dfa06fda819d
confirmations
267351
spent
true